Wiki Page - Chronos Twins DX - [edit]

This game used to be playable up to version 5.0-3627 (included)

Version 5.0-3635 broke it (doesn't boot, black screen and crashes the emulator, have to kill it with task manager).

Starting from version 5.0 5726 ... the bug is different, the import WAD dialog appears, and then "WAD installation failed, cannot import content 00000013", and then Dolphin crashes.
I checked this last commit, and it's related to a WAD hack that was removed. So not sure if somehow this title was working before because of a hack, or something else is going on.

Tested with D3D and all defaults.
Your problem is most likely caused by 5.0-3631 rather than 5.0-3635 (though I don't blame you for not getting the version number exactly right, since builds aren't available for 5.0-3631). Anyway, it's possible that something is wrong with your WAD file rather than the game itself. Can you explain how you dumped the WAD?
